Introduction: The 5-M Framework in Accounting

The 5-M framework – Manpower, Material, Machine, Method, and Money – offers a structured approach to analyzing and solving problems across various disciplines. This framework is particularly useful in cost accounting, management accounting, and financial accounting, helping to pinpoint areas for improvement and optimization. In accounting, this framework helps dissect complex scenarios into manageable components, allowing for a more systematic and efficient problem-solving process. On top of that, by considering each 'M' individually, accountants can identify the root cause of accounting discrepancies, inefficiencies, or errors. 1. Manpower: The Human Element in Accounting

This aspect encompasses all aspects related to the human resources involved in the accounting process. This includes:

  • Skills and Expertise: Do employees possess the necessary skills and knowledge to perform their accounting tasks accurately and efficiently? A lack of training or expertise can lead to errors, delays, and ultimately, inaccurate financial reporting. Example: A lack of understanding of Generally Accepted Accounting Principles (GAAP) can result in improper revenue recognition.

  • Efficiency and Productivity: Are employees working efficiently and productively? Are there bottlenecks or delays in the accounting process? Example: Inefficient data entry processes can lead to significant delays in financial reporting.

  • Staffing Levels: Is there adequate staffing to handle the workload? Understaffing can lead to burnout and errors, while overstaffing can be an unnecessary expense. Example: During peak seasons like tax season, additional temporary staff might be required.

  • Motivation and Morale: Are employees motivated and engaged in their work? Low morale can lead to decreased productivity and higher error rates. Example: Implementing employee recognition programs can improve morale and reduce errors.

Problem Solving Example: A company notices a consistent increase in errors in its accounts receivable department. Using the manpower perspective, they might analyze employee training, workload distribution, and staff motivation to identify the root cause. Potential solutions could include additional training, improved workflow processes, or employee incentives.

2. Material: Resources Used in Accounting Operations

"Material" in this context refers to the physical resources and information used in the accounting process. This includes:

  • Data Accuracy: Is the underlying data used for accounting accurate and reliable? Inaccurate data will invariably lead to inaccurate financial reporting. Example: Incorrect inventory counts can significantly impact the cost of goods sold.

  • Information Systems: Are the accounting information systems efficient and reliable? Outdated or poorly designed systems can lead to errors and inefficiencies. Example: Using a manual accounting system in a large organization can be prone to errors and slow down processes.

  • Documentation: Is proper documentation maintained for all accounting transactions? Adequate documentation is crucial for auditing and compliance purposes. Example: Lack of proper documentation for depreciation calculations can lead to audit findings.

  • Physical Resources: This includes office supplies, computers, and other physical assets necessary for efficient accounting operations. Example: Lack of sufficient printer ink can delay important report generation.

Problem Solving Example: A company's financial statements consistently show discrepancies. Using the material perspective, they would examine the accuracy of their underlying data, the reliability of their information systems, and the adequacy of their documentation. Potential solutions might include implementing better data validation procedures, upgrading their accounting software, or implementing a reliable document management system.

3. Machine: Technology and Equipment in Accounting

This element refers to the technology and equipment used in the accounting process. This includes:

  • Accounting Software: Is the accounting software efficient, reliable, and user-friendly? Example: Using outdated software may lack crucial features needed for compliance with modern accounting standards.

  • Hardware: Are the computers and other hardware sufficient for the workload? Example: Slow computers can hinder the efficiency of accounting staff.

  • Network Infrastructure: Is the network infrastructure reliable and secure? Network failures can disrupt accounting operations and compromise data security. Example: A poorly secured network can expose sensitive financial data to cyber threats.

  • Automation Tools: Are automation tools being effectively utilized to streamline processes and reduce manual effort? Example: Automating invoice processing can significantly reduce errors and save time.

Problem Solving Example: A company experiences frequent system crashes, resulting in lost productivity and potential data loss. Using the machine perspective, they would analyze their hardware, software, and network infrastructure for vulnerabilities. Solutions might include upgrading their hardware, implementing better data backup procedures, or migrating to a cloud-based accounting system.

4. Method: Accounting Procedures and Processes

This element focuses on the accounting procedures and processes used within an organization. This includes:

  • Internal Controls: Are effective internal controls in place to prevent errors and fraud? Strong internal controls are vital for ensuring the accuracy and reliability of financial reporting. Example: Segregation of duties is a crucial internal control to prevent fraud.

  • Workflow Processes: Are the accounting workflows efficient and streamlined? Inefficient workflows can lead to delays and errors. Example: Improving the approval process for expense reports can speed up reimbursements.

  • Accounting Policies: Are clear and consistent accounting policies in place? Consistent application of accounting policies is crucial for ensuring comparability of financial data over time. Example: Having a well-defined policy for capitalizing vs. expensing assets is essential for consistent financial reporting.

  • Audit Procedures: Are regular audits conducted to ensure the accuracy and reliability of financial statements? Regular audits help identify and address potential issues before they escalate. Example: Internal audits can help identify weaknesses in internal controls.

Problem Solving Example: A company notices a significant increase in accounting errors. Using the method perspective, they would examine their internal controls, workflow processes, and accounting policies for weaknesses. Potential solutions might include strengthening internal controls, streamlining workflows, or revising accounting policies.

5. Money: Financial Resources and Budget

This aspect encompasses the financial resources and budget allocated to the accounting function. This includes:

  • Budget Allocation: Is sufficient budget allocated to the accounting function to support its operations? Inadequate funding can limit the resources available for improving processes and systems. Example: Insufficient budget for software upgrades can hinder efficiency.

  • Cost Control: Are effective cost control measures in place to manage expenses? Controlling costs is crucial for maintaining profitability. Example: Implementing a system for tracking and approving expenses can reduce unnecessary spending.

  • Investment in Technology: Is sufficient investment being made in technology to improve efficiency and accuracy? Investing in new technologies can significantly improve the accounting function. Example: Implementing robotic process automation (RPA) can automate many manual accounting tasks.

  • Return on Investment (ROI): Is the return on investment from accounting processes and technologies satisfactory? Analyzing the ROI of accounting investments is crucial for justifying expenditures. Example: Analyzing the cost savings from implementing a new accounting software versus the cost of the software itself.

Problem Solving Example: A company is struggling to manage its expenses. Using the money perspective, they would review their budget allocation, cost control measures, and the ROI of their accounting investments. Potential solutions might include implementing stricter cost control measures, investing in technology to improve efficiency, or reallocating budget to higher-priority areas.

Applying the 5-M Framework: A Case Study

Let's consider a scenario where a company's accounts payable department is experiencing significant delays in processing invoices. Applying the 5-M framework, we can analyze the problem as follows:

  • Manpower: Is the department adequately staffed? Do employees have sufficient training on the AP software? Are employees overworked or experiencing low morale?

  • Material: Are the invoices being received accurately and completely? Is there a solid system for tracking invoices? Is the data entry process efficient?

  • Machine: Is the accounting software outdated or inadequate? Are the computers used by the department fast and reliable? Is there a reliable network connection?

  • Method: Are there clear and efficient workflows for processing invoices? Are there adequate internal controls in place to prevent errors and fraud? Are there regular reconciliation processes?

  • Money: Is sufficient budget allocated to the department to invest in better technology or training? Are there cost-saving measures that could be implemented?

By carefully considering each of these factors, the company can identify the root cause of the delays and implement appropriate solutions. These solutions might include hiring additional staff, upgrading the accounting software, improving workflows, or investing in training for the employees.

Frequently Asked Questions (FAQs)

Q: Is the 5-M framework applicable to all accounting problems?

A: While the 5-M framework is a versatile tool, its applicability may vary depending on the specific nature of the problem. Because of that, for simple accounting errors, a more focused approach might suffice. On the flip side, for complex issues affecting the entire accounting process, the 5-M framework provides a structured and comprehensive approach.

Q: How can I prioritize which 'M' to focus on first?

A: Prioritization depends on the specific problem. To give you an idea, if there's a significant increase in accounting errors, you may prioritize "Manpower" and "Method" first to investigate employee skills and workflow processes. If the problem is slow processing times, "Machine" and "Method" might take precedence. A careful analysis of the symptoms should guide your prioritization.

Q: Can the 5-M framework be used for preventing problems?

A: Absolutely! Regular assessments of each 'M' can proactively identify potential issues before they escalate into major problems. The 5-M framework is equally effective for preventative measures. This allows for preventative measures like staff training, system upgrades, or process improvements.

Q: How can I document my findings using the 5-M framework?

A: Create a clear and structured report, addressing each 'M' individually. Include your findings, analysis, and proposed solutions for each element. Using tables or charts can help visualize your findings effectively.
